Can from Bierkoning, Amsterdam. Fruity hop aroma with citrus, grassy notes, mandarin, and light malt. Lightly sweet flavour with a medium bitterness. Body is light to medium. Easy and fruity, citrus-forward hops, elegant IPA.

12 ounce can. Medium gold pour. Small frothy beige head. Fresh citrus hop aroma hints at lemon peel. Light bready malt flavor. Notes of grapefruit, lemon and kiwi. Some piney notes in finish. Decent Session IPA.

Bottle from Total Wine in Sacramento, CA. Pours light gold with a white head. Aroma is light stone fruits. Med body? Not quite. Flavor is very light pale malt with some Mandarin citrus. Nicely bitter; quite clean. Very light, but the citrus is at a decent level, and the bitterness is adequate. Really a good candidate for lake, beach or pool.

On tap at the Barrel House. It pours a clear light yellow gold color with a white head. The aroma has lots of fruity passionfruit and mango notes. Light grass and hints of malty sweetness. The flavor is nice. More passionfruit and grapefruit with some strong grassy bitterness. Light bodied with very light hints of crystal malt. Pretty much a hop bomb. Nice stuff.
